Transaction ddcd30140fd8a99d2fa2186fffca54b3aabce0633ca993724b2325c7144dcea0
1 Input
1 Output
-
ddcd30140fd8a99d2fa2186fffca54b3aabce0633ca993724b2325c7144dcea0:0
- value
- 166529464
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e376ffb8f0aa15e4b48a94ca59da97a3db0acde3 OP_EQUAL
- address
- 3NRjsH8PHgYJW62ZerYnHNgdQ1cF95q156